The technological advancements in smart buildings drive a paradigm shift in building management and sustainability.
FREMONT, CA: Smart buildings continue to revolutionize the way we interact with and manage the spaces we inhabit. The rapid advancement of technology has led to smart buildings with cutting-edge solutions for energy efficiency, security, and overall occupant experience. These technological advancements can potentially reshape the future of building management and sustainability. One of the key technological advancements in smart buildings is the integration of Internet of Things (IoT) devices and sensors. These devices enable real-time monitoring and control of various environmental variables within a building. By leveraging IoT devices, smart buildings can efficiently manage energy consumption, optimize lighting and temperature settings, and automate maintenance processes. This leads to reduced operational costs and contributes to a more sustainable and eco-friendly environment.
Furthermore, adopting advanced energy management programs has become a hallmark of smart buildings. These programs utilize sophisticated algorithms and data analytics to lower CO2 emissions and minimize energy usage. Through smart energy management, buildings can intelligently adjust their energy consumption based on occupancy patterns and external environmental factors, ultimately promoting greater energy efficiency and environmental sustainability. In the security realm, smart buildings have seen significant advancements with the automation of access control and surveillance systems. The integration of video cameras, biometric authentication, and access control systems driven by artificial intelligence has strengthened the security infrastructure of modern buildings. This ensures the safety of occupants and provides real-time monitoring and response capabilities to mitigate potential security threats.

Moreover, smart buildings embrace sustainable mobility options as part of their technological advancements. Infrastructure for bike sharing, electric vehicle charging stations, and intelligent parking management systems are being integrated into building designs to encourage eco-friendly transportation options. By promoting sustainable mobility within their premises, smart buildings contribute to the larger goal of reducing carbon emissions and promoting environmentally conscious practices. Looking ahead, the future of smart buildings holds even more promise with the integration of emerging technologies such as blockchain and machine learning. These technologies could introduce new levels of automation, personalization, and security in building management. By harnessing the power of blockchain for secure data management and machine learning for predictive analytics, smart buildings can unlock unprecedented levels of operational efficiency and occupant satisfaction. With the continuous evolution of technology, smart buildings are poised to redefine how we perceive and interact with the spaces we inhabit.
